WitrynaIn propositional logic, modus ponens (/ ˈ m oʊ d ə s ˈ p oʊ n ɛ n z /; MP), also known as modus ponendo ponens (Latin for "method of putting by placing"), implication elimination, or affirming the antecedent, is a deductive argument form and rule of inference. It can be summarized as "P implies Q. P is true.Therefore Q must also be true.". Modus …

I learned that ⊨ stands for semantic entailment, while ⊢ stands for provability in a certain proof system. More concretely: Given a set of formulas Γ and a formula φ in some logic (e.g., first-order logic), Γ ⊨ φ means that every model of Γ is also a model of φ. The problem is, as you no doubt know from arguing with friends, not all arguments are good arguments. A “bad” argument is one in which the conclusion does not follow from the premises, i.e., the conclusion is not a consequence of the premises.
